A school named Asha Kiran for specially-abled children provides free education and food in a backward jungle area of Bihar. This school is located in the Rajgir district of Bihar, which is encircled by the five holy hills. It lies at a distance of approximately 34 km from the city of Gaya. Children from not only the nearby areas but even as far as Jharkhand attend this school.
